OPTICAL RESONATORS FOR HIGH POWER FREE ELECTRON LASERS A NEW APPROACH

摘要

A new class of optical resonators for high power free electron lasers is defined and described. The special geometry of the resonator's mirrors allows for special field distribution in the resonator's volume. The resonator is an open one characterized by the fundamental mode having ring distribution on the cavity mirrors and focused distribution in the center of the cavity between the mirrors. Such distribution is advantageous for electron outcoupling of the radiation power from free electron laser and diminishing the required level of intracavity radiation intensity.
